Легенда

Код с удвоением количества разрядов работает так: берется двоичное представление числа, и каждая двоичная единица «1» преобразуется в «10», а каждый двоичный ноль «0» преобразуется в «01». Таким образом, вместо кодового слова 1010011 передается 10011001011010. Ошибка обнаруживается в том случае, если в парных элементах будут одинаковые символы 00 или 11 (вместо 01 и 10).

Задача: написать программу, которая представляет десятичное число в двоичном виде, закодированном удвоением количества разрядов.

Видео-разбор


Last modified: Tuesday, 15 December 2020, 9:18 AM